- Location-aware applications are growing - from retail shopping to improving commercial navigation maps and sharing them to point/click search to displaying (globally collected) local info on a giant wall screen in real time - and with more ways to get the location including improved Wi-Fi fix.
- Wibree merges into Bluetooth as a low-power variant.
- Boingo roams into community-based network.
- Inline advertising now comes to mobile messaging and mobile video.
- Sprint combines iDEN/walkie-talkie and CDMA.
- New touch based phone from HTC is introduced. Meanwhile while both SonyEricsson and Nokia introduce enhanced multimedia phones they now keep in mind that lower price and enterprise functionality (like e-mail access) are important for consumers - in same way as multimedia can be important for enterprise.
- Palm joins other vendor and introduces Internet companion device (and gets more money to implement that strategy) - while Sony PSP is becoming such a device (they btw cost just €98 in Finland now, funny price).
- More better cheap reliable push e-mail solutions.
- Livescribe provides way to capture simultaneous pen and audio input on the go. Nice way to collect your thoughts and impressions.
